Output 851bd5177dc8ba54552ff8c0b327f19ddccb7e0e542abed18ec03b9fe30ade55:27

value
3144708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 727b3da0efae08dc12383640838bffb039b5aa21 OP_EQUAL
address
3C8LbL2pGYG9xp2UPfnjsKR6KaDuBEq8do
transaction
851bd5177dc8ba54552ff8c0b327f19ddccb7e0e542abed18ec03b9fe30ade55
spent
true